Cycling and Hiking
Žgaljići is included in the moderately difficult MTB route 425 “U sjeni velikih hrastova”. The 20-kilometre circular route with 377 metres of elevation gain leads via Milohnići, Brzac, Poljica, Žgaljići, Pinezići and Linardići back to Milohnići. The route combines asphalt, gravel, old cart tracks and narrower rocky sections lined with dry-stone walls.
In the immediate route surroundings, route 425 connects the section near Žgaljići with cultural sites around Poljica and in the western Krk hinterland. These include the Church of Saints Cosmas and Damian in Poljica and the Chapel of St. Sixtus between Pinezići and Linardići.
In the immediate surroundings, the H128 U sjeni velikih hrastova begins in Poljica, a predominantly easy 6.6-kilometre hike. In the immediate surroundings, B-430 Udahnite Šotovento is described as an easy cycling tour around Šotovento. In the immediate surroundings, H130 Tragovima povijesti do Sv. Krševana is a 7.2-kilometre hike of moderate difficulty through wooded natural areas with cultural heritage. In the immediate surroundings, the route reaches the Chapel of St. Krševan, dating from the 12th century, above Čavlena Bay.
Culture and Townscape
The Šotovento settlements, of which Žgaljići is one, preserve an original urban structure of grouped stone houses. Near Žgaljići, the Chapel of St. Krševan features an irregular trefoil ground plan, a vaulted central space and cross-shaped windows. The nearby Church of St. Krševan was built on the remains of an ancient rustic villa.
Near Žgaljići, in Poljica, the bell tower of the parish church of Saints Cosmas and Damian was built in the second half of the 18th century and is described as an architectural symbol of the settlement. The nearby bell tower of the parish church of Saints Cosmas and Damian in Poljica is made of finely worked stone and is a recognisable landmark of the settlement. The ethnographic zone of Poljica includes Žgaljići, Poljica, Bajčići, Nenadići and Brusići.
Nature and History
Nearby, the large oak at Čavlena is described as being 400 years old and 20 metres high, with a 30-metre crown and a trunk circumference of more than five metres.
Near Žgaljići, in Glavotok, the Franciscan monastery preserves Glagolitic inscriptions and manuscripts. The Church of the Immaculate Conception of the Blessed Virgin Mary near Žgaljići, in Glavotok, features stylistic characteristics of the Renaissance and Baroque. In addition, the first printing press on the island of Krk operated nearby, in Glavotok, in the second half of the 19th century.
Regional Speciality
Nearby, route B-427 at the House of Krk Prosciutto in Vrh lists the opportunity for cyclists to taste Krk prosciutto. This is a Croatian product registered at EU level.
